Transaction 8bfefcd2c7c4ee461fabb55820a8df66921f0ac90de11a678a5852e81206eaa5

1 Input
2 Outputs
  • 8bfefcd2c7c4ee461fabb55820a8df66921f0ac90de11a678a5852e81206eaa5:0
  • value  13314139
    address  3DAgHGvVFX8zc7mMFVF4puffPbiXJaa8aA
  • 8bfefcd2c7c4ee461fabb55820a8df66921f0ac90de11a678a5852e81206eaa5:1
  • value  420146
    address  33KiXSckLvRn2W4jVeL4TtZHtA7zmXGj6L